Hi, I have a 4-year-old who goes to Lutheran Living Savior Preschool on Long Shoals. I think this is the best preschool based on the teachers' education, teacher-student ratio, and the program quality. (I have training in curriculum.) Other great preschools in this area are Skyland United Methodist Around the Son, Arden Presbyterian Preschool, and Nativity Preschool. Let me know if you need a contact for either Living Savior or Nativity Preschool. A friend told me that Glenn Marlow Kindergarten teachers recommended Arden Pres and Nativity to her. - Nermina

My son, who is now in first grade, went to Arden Pres for 3 years, through the 3- and 4-year-old programs and the kindergarten. He was more than prepared for a full-day kindergarten at Glen Arden. (He has a late summer birthday, so we had him in half days at Arden Pres the put him in full day when he was 6 at Glen Arden.) We loved Arden Pres! But I also have several friends who are thrilled with the education kids get at Nativity and Around the Son.
